<blockquote data-quote="Tobes" data-source="post: 909272" data-attributes="member: 13888"><p>I would get stands for the bookshelfs, put them next to the tv stand and toe them in slightly. You'll get a much better centre stage. Bass might be less then what it can be seeing that there's no wall behind them, but some bookshelfs work well like that depending on the room.</p></blockquote><p></p>
